Nick Pace

Term: 
July 1, 2026 to June 30, 2027

Nick Pace is a senior Finance and Accounting student at the University of Kentucky and serves as the Student Body President through the Student Government Association. In this role, he represents more than 38,000 students, advocates for student needs, and works alongside university leadership to strengthen the student experience. He is working through strategic initiatives and responsible promotion of resources to students. His administration's pillars are built around transparency, accessibility, unity, and support for all students.

A Louisville, Kentucky native, Nick is a member of the Wall Street Scholars program and is pursuing a Bachelor of Business Administration with an expected graduation date of May 2027. Prior to serving as Student Body President, he held the roles as the Executive Director of Operations and Director of Assessment in the Student Government Association, where he oversaw executive operations, helped develop an internal budgeting system, and mentored emerging student leaders through the Leadership Development Program. His interests include leadership, finance and accounting, and public service, with a passion for creating meaningful opportunities that positively impact others.

Nick is the fourth generation of his family to attend the University of Kentucky, following his great-grandmother, Prewitt Evans, his father, Julian Pace, and his sister, Amelia Pace.
